Charki Pahari
Charki Pahari is a village located in Chandwara subdivision of Kodarma district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 7km away from sub-district headquarter Chandwara (tehsildar office) and 15km away from district headquarter Koderma. As per 2009 stats, Birsodih is the gram panchayat of Charki Pahari village.

About Charki Pahari
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Charki Pahari is 350055. The village spans a total geographical area of 232 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 825324. Jhumri Tilaiya is nearest town to Charki Pahari village for all major economic activities.
When it comes to local governance, Charki Pahari village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Barkatha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Kodarma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Charki Pahari
According to the 2011 Census, Charki Pahari has a total population of about 1,112, with approximately 572 males and 540 females. The sex ratio is around 944 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 194 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 169 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 51.35%, with male literacy at about 62.59% and female literacy near 39.44%. There are around 191 households in the village. Connectivity of Charki Pahari
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Charki Pahari. As per the 2011 stats, Charki Pahari had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
